Who are Potere al Popolo!?

Potere al Popolo! (Power to the People!) is an Italian political movement, which began in November of 2017. We participated in the March 2018 Italian elections, amplifying the voices of workers, precarious youth, migrants, and the unemployed, inside an electoral process that saw a populist far-right triumph over a center-left which had cultivated and entrenched a devasting neoliberal program for decades. Building with militants, young and old, we fostered a network that based on the basic realities of life and the local and larger experiences everyday people experience. We founded a national organization whose goals aim to bridge the disconnect between elected officials and social activism, between the party and the grassroots movement; we believe that popular power is born both in the streets and in the institutions, in the neighbourhoods and in the workplace. In fact, as the word “democracy” (literally: the power of the people) still carries important meaning, it is necessary to free the word from what is instead signified by the delegation, passivity, and resignation felt across the world by working people, and to experiment at every level, by building solidarity and common struggle, i.e. a rejuvenated way of practicing politics.

Why is PaP! becoming active outside of the Italian context?

Potere al Popolo! is the only political force in Italy that has dozens of active assemblies outside of the country in Europe and, indeed, elsewhere. On the one hand, this is an expression of the huge emigration out of Italy (mostly by youth) that has been profoundly visible since the 2008 financial crisis, and on the other hand, of the interests that Italians have in keeping a link with their country while they are abroad. PaP! has always given the upmost attention to these common struggles and conditions, which is a key tool in responding to what, for us, is a fundamental human tendency: to create struggle collectively.
